BJ spacers don't effect ride quality. The internet is just great for good information isn't it?

If you leave your torsion bars turned to stock, bj spacers lift about an inch... lil bit more. They force the lower A-arm down which in turn makes the truck a bit higher upfront.

They change the front geometry and put more stress on the idler arm. Changing the torsion bar crank/turn effects camber more exagerated after you install spacers. So an alignment or decent knowledge of alignment is necessary to get the wheels to sit right. Which also effects toe..

It messes everything up but if done right, bj spacers are an improvement.

As for before n after, its almost fruitless to post pics. It's noticeable but the goal of BJ's ... besides the good feeling... oh i mean spacers is for performance not looks. If you want looks a body lift is cheaper and easier. (no cutting of metal and screwing with steering). =)

You can fit 33's comfortably upfront after bj spacers.

longer shackles will lift a rear enough to accommodate the front lift.

OME are aftermarket shocks. OME = Old Man Emu many confuse it with OEM. You need longer shocks than stock to take advantage of your extra 1.5"+ of travel

The link in my sig should have the actual shock number that I'm running. I've been very happy with the bj spacers, low profile compressions bumpstops, OME shocks, and left the tbars alone. Got a brace for the idler arm and I'm testing bronze bushings for SDORI (who makes the bj spacers).
